Abstract :
Organizations nowadays invest heavily in business intelligence (BI) systems to get insights from their increasingly large volumes of complex data, support decision making and achieve competitive advantages. The visualization capability of a BI system in terms of developing effective visualizations for addressing business problems is crucial to the success of BI. With the rapid advances achieved in the domain of information visualization, many existing visualization techniques/applications can provide reasonable support for particular paradigms, problem domains, and data types. However, they are still weak for supporting multi-paradigm, multi-domain problems and maintaining visualization effectiveness under dynamic contexts. BI systems need to include visualization subsystems or be used together with separate visualization systems that offer flexible support for creating, manipulating and transforming visualization solutions. In this paper, we discuss business visualization context and propose and implement a context adaptive visualization framework. Furthermore, we demonstrate the framework implementation through a sequence of context-driven illustrations.
